Embodiment Construction

[0034] like figure 1 and figure 2 As shown, a straight-through welded jacket valve includes a valve body 1, a jacket 2 is set on the valve body, and the two ends of the valve body are respectively set beyond the two ends of the jacket, and the valve body is set beyond the jacket. The length of the part where the sleeve is set is L, and L is 10-15cm. The jacket is fixed to the valve body through the positioning piece 3, the inner end of the positioning piece is welded to the outer wall of the valve body, and the outer end of the positioning piece is connected to the outer wall of the valve body. Abstract

The invention discloses a straight through type welding jacket valve. The straight through type welding jacket valve comprises a valve body, wherein the valve body is covered with a jacket, and the jacket is fixed on the valve body through a positioning piece; a medium channel is formed between the inner wall of the jacket and the outer wall of the valve body; the two ends of the jacket are opened; and a guide inlet and a guide outlet of the medium channel are defined by the inner walls of the two ends of the jacket and the outer wall of the valve body, and are communicated through the medium channel. The valve body is covered with the jacket so that a double-layer structure is formed; the two ends of the jacket are opened, and define the guide inlet and the guide outlet with the valve body; compared with a cross-under pipe type jacket valve in which the ends of the jacket and the valve body are sealed by a plate body in the prior art, the straight through type welding jacket valve eliminates the troubles brought by cross-under pipes, reduces the medium operation resistance brought by the cross-under pipes, reduces the energy consumption of equipment for driving a medium to flow, decreases the equipment cost, saves the electric energy in the operation period, reduces the construction cost and the operation cost, and largely reduces the possibility of leading in a pollution source in the end processing of the jacket valve.

Description

technical field [0001] The invention relates to a straight-through welding jacket valve. Background technique [0002] At present, there is no uniform standard for the manufacture of jacketed valves in China. Each manufacturer manufactures them under the conditions of the process according to their own experience. Through our long-term summary, we found that all jacketed valves on the market have a common feature that is to have a jumper. The design in actual engineering is based on the jacketed pipe design specification. The jacketed pipe includes an inner pipe and an outer pipe. The inner pipe circulates industrial materials, and the medium flows between the outer pipe and the inner pipe. The most widely used jacketed pipe inner pipe is DN15. --When DN50 is designed, the diameter of the crossover pipe is DN15, and when DN80--DN250, the designed crossover pipe is DN20.
